The Rams just shipped Jarquez Hunter to Miami, and that makes Dean Connors a name dynasty managers should stash before the market notices. PlayerProfiler gives Connors a 96th-percentile College Target Share (14.4%), and he enters the NFL with the receiving profile to carve out a complementary role while sitting behind Kyren Williams and Blake Corum.

 

Connors posted 1,231 total yards and nine touchdowns at Houston in 2025, and his 4.53 forty with a 90th-percentile Burst Score gives Sean McVay another athletic back to deploy if the depth chart opens up. This is exactly the type of cheap dynasty lottery ticket worth burning a roster spot on, Connors does not need an immediate role to become a valuable asset if the Rams backfield turns over.
